本文主要涉及MySQL中的注釋方式及其應用場景。MySQL中的注釋可以幫助開發人員更好地理解和維護代碼,提高代碼的可讀性和可維護性。下面是一些常見的MySQL注釋方式及其應用場景。
1. 單行注釋
單行注釋使用“--”或“#”符號開頭,可以在語句中的任何位置添加注釋。單行注釋只對當前行有效。
-- 查詢用戶表中的所有數據
SELECT * FROM user;
# 查詢用戶表中的所有數據
SELECT * FROM user;
2. 多行注釋
多行注釋使用“/*”和“*/”符號包裹,可以在語句中的任何位置添加注釋。多行注釋可以跨越多行,對包含的所有語句都有效。
/* 查詢用戶表中的所有數據 */
SELECT * FROM user;
3. 存儲過程注釋
存儲過程注釋使用“-- ”或“#”符號開頭,可以在存儲過程中的任何位置添加注釋。存儲過程注釋只對當前行有效。
CREATE PROCEDURE get_user(IN id INT)
BEGIN
-- 查詢用戶表中指定id的數據
SELECT * FROM user WHERE id = id;
4. 函數注釋
函數注釋使用“-- ”或“#”符號開頭,可以在函數中的任何位置添加注釋。函數注釋只對當前行有效。
ame(IN id INT) RETURNS VARCHAR(255)
BEGIN
-- 查詢用戶表中指定id的用戶名ame VARCHAR(255);ameame FROM user WHERE id = id;ame;
MySQL中的注釋方式包括單行注釋、多行注釋、存儲過程注釋和函數注釋。不同的注釋方式適用于不同的場景。開發人員可以根據需要選擇合適的注釋方式,提高代碼的可讀性和可維護性。